Name list of Nigeria's new cabinet after reshuffle

Nigerian President Umaru Yar'Adua on Wednesday swore in 16 new ministers and re-assigned some old ones, bringing to 37 the number of cabinet members in the government.

Below is the full list of ministers and their portfolios:

1. Mike Aondoakaa, Attorney General & Minister of Justice

2. S. Abba Ruma, Minister of Agriculture & Water Resources

3. Fidelia A. Njeze (female), Minister of State, Agric & Water Resources

4. Babatunde Omotoba, Minister of Aviation

5. Bello J. Gada, Minister of Culture & Tourism

6. Shettima Mustapha, Minister of Defence

7. Ademola Seriki, Minister of State, Defence

8. Sam Egwu, Minister of Education

9. Hajia Aishatu Dukku, Minister of State, Education

10. John Odeh, Minister of Environment

11. M.A. Aliero, Minister of FCT (Federal Capital Territory)

12. J.C. Odom, Minister of State, FCT

13. Remi Babalola, Minister of State, Finance

14. Ojo Maduekwe, Minister of Foreign Affairs

15. Alhaji Jibril Maigari, Minister of State, Foreign Affairs, I

16. Bagudu Hirse, Minister of State, Foreign Affairs, II

17. B. Osotimehin, Minister of Health

18. A.I. Hong, Minister of State, Health

19. D. Akunyili, Minister of Information & Communication

20. Alhaji Aliyu Ikra Bilbis, Minister of State, Information & Communication

21. Godwin Abbe, Minister of Interior

22. Chief A. Kayode, Minister of Labor

23. Deziani Allison- Madueke (female), Minister of Mines & Steel Development

24. Shamsudeen Usman, Deputy Chairman/Minister of National Planning Commission

25. Elder G. Orubebe, Minister of State, Niger Delta Affairs

26. Rilwanu Lukman, Minister of Petroleum

27. O. Ajumogobia, Minister of State, Petroleum

28. I.Y. Lame, Minister of Police Affairs

29. Arch. Nuhu Wya, Minister of State, Power

30. A. B. Zaku, Minister of Science & Technology

31. S.M. Ndanusa, Minister/Chairman National Sports Commission

32. Alhaji Ibrahim Bio, Minister of Transport

33. S.H. Sulaiman (f), Minister of Women Affairs

34. Hassan M. Lawal, Minister of Works & Housing

35. Grace Ekpiwhre, Minister of State, Works & Housing

36. A. Olasunkanmi, Minister of Youth Development

37. A. Kazaure, Minister of Special Duties
